Can the Stutterer Speak Truth to Power?: Writer's Introduction

A little something about me that has a lot to do with writing as my preferred medium of communication is that I am a stutterer with social anxiety and ADHD. There are times when I just can't speak my mind because my throat prevents me too. This is where writing has always come in. I am more articulate when I write and to look at the words on the page or the screen gives me a sense of security
